buwie Posted August 28, 2005 Share Posted August 28, 2005 Beware if you have the following firewire controller: Texas Instruments TSB43AB22/A IEEE-1394a-2000 Controller. Even when booting in safe mode (it tried everything i can think of, -s -x -F) OSX86 will stall right after loading it. It tells you its working ok and that will be the last line you see. Remove or rename the *FireW* and *FW* extensions while following one of the guides, the Blender patched DVD won't work when you have this controller.
